3.3.3.11.1 ALTER MACHINE
This command alters attributes of a compute node or storage cell in an engineered
system.
Syntax
ALTER MACHINE { DNSSERVERS='dns_servers' | GATEWAYADAPTER=gateway_adapter |
HOSTNAMEADAPTER=hostname_adapter | NTPSERVERS= 'ntp_servers' |
TIMEZONE = timezone }
WHERE {
ID = machine_id |
HOSTNAME = hostname |
CLUSTERNUMBER = cluster_number COMPUTENUMBER = compute_number |
CLUSTERNUMBER = cluster_number STORAGENUMBER = storage_number |
CLUSTERNAME = cluster_name COMPUTENUMBER = compute_number |
CLUSTERNAME = cluster_name STORAGENUMBER = storage_number |
CLUSTERID = cluster_id COMPUTENUMBER = compute_number |
CLUSTERID = cluster_id STORAGENUMBER = storage_number }
